Principal ASIC Engineer, Annapurna Labs

Published Date: May 13, 2026
Annapurna Labs (U.S.) Inc., Cupertino, CA
Job Description:

Amazon Web Services (AWS) is seeking experienced Physical Design Engineers to join the Silicon Optimization Engineering Team, responsible for designing and optimizing hardware for AWS data centers. This role involves leveraging new technologies to enhance large-scale deployments, ensuring a world-class customer experience in a fast-paced environment.

Responsibilities:

  • Collaborate with RTL/logic designers to conduct architectural feasibility studies and assess power-performance-area tradeoffs for physical design closure.
  • Drive block physical implementation processes including synthesis, formal verification, floor planning, bus/pin planning, place and route, power/clock distribution, congestion analysis, timing closure, IR drop analysis, physical verification, ECO, and sign-off.
  • Develop and refine physical design methodologies.
  • Evaluate third-party IP and provide recommendations based on findings.
  • Foster collaboration and teamwork with other physical design engineers and RTL/Architecture teams.

Qualifications:

  • Bachelor's degree with 12+ years of experience or Master's degree with 8+ years in Electrical Engineering or Computer Science.
  • 6+ years of experience in ASIC Physical Design from RTL to GDSII in technologies such as 7nm, 14/16nm, 20nm, or 28nm.
  • Proficiency in CAD tools (e.g., Cadence, Mentor Graphics, Synopsys) for various physical design tasks.
  • Scripting experience in Tcl, Perl, or Python.

Skills:

  • Expertise in physical design flows including synthesis, formal verification, floor planning, and timing closure.
  • Strong knowledge of device physics and custom/semi-custom implementation techniques.
  • Experience in integrating IP and specifying IP requirements in the physical domain.
  • Ability to solve physical design challenges across various technologies like DDR and PCIe.
  • Mentorship skills to guide junior engineers and foster effective teamwork.
